Transaction e78843a0e440353dcf60420f33b5b590db88859af129d9c1991adfa14bdfe013
1 Input
1 Output
-
e78843a0e440353dcf60420f33b5b590db88859af129d9c1991adfa14bdfe013:0
- value
- 67144
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3af7ce0ba353f04a6cb71e27ef496c087ad78c6f OP_EQUAL
- address
- 374oyTGow6uNyo6tUrhNPA8hyRQbWqxLmU